For a small-cap consumer name like HNST, the stock usually trades less on the prepared remarks than on whether channel data and inventory commentary line up with the reported run-rate; any mismatch tends to show up quickly in the next 1-2 trading sessions.
The important second-order issue is margin quality. If management is protecting volume with discounting, that can look fine in revenue but still compress gross margin and force higher trade spend, which is usually where small consumer brands lose the multiple first. In that scenario, larger incumbents and broadline staples proxies such as PG or CHD are relatively insulated because they can defend shelf space without sacrificing as much unit economics.
